5 Effective Workouts to Increase Your Pitching Velocity

5 Effective Workouts to Increase Your Pitching Velocity

Short answer workouts to throw a baseball harder: Focus on strengthening your core, legs, and shoulder muscles through exercises such as planks, squats, and resistance band rotations. Also practice explosive throwing drills to improve technique and power. Consistency and patience is key for progress in pitching speed. Cracking the Code: Understanding SP Rankings in Fantasy Baseball

sp rankings fantasy baseball

Short answer sp rankings fantasy baseball: SP rankings in fantasy baseball refer to the rankings of starting pitchers. These are determined based on the performance of pitchers during previous seasons and their projected performance for the current season.
